L-Carnitine research overview

L-Carnitine is a quaternary ammonium metabolite involved in the carnitine shuttle that transfers long-chain acyl groups across mitochondrial membranes.

What is L-Carnitine?

Biochemical studies of carnitine/acylcarnitine exchange and carnitine palmitoyltransferase complexes support its role in mitochondrial substrate transport.

Primary sources

  1. Ramsay and Tubbs, Biochemical Journal (1986) — Carnitine and acylcarnitine transport in submitochondrial particles. DOI: 10.1042/bj2350297
  2. Lee et al., Journal of Biological Chemistry (2011) — Study of CPT1A-associated outer-mitochondrial-membrane fatty-acid transfer complexes. DOI: 10.1074/jbc.M111.228692
